Output e821b0051a955a5ce6aa9c59fc70af668b6117f74befc012cac79e7bed2f5555:2

value
19167284
script pubkey
OP_0 OP_PUSHBYTES_20 dc711c87d5d5feb12e557bf02cf4f5f2d984aed2
address
bc1qm3c3ep746hltztj400czea847tvcftkj8jdas6
transaction
e821b0051a955a5ce6aa9c59fc70af668b6117f74befc012cac79e7bed2f5555
confirmations
270749
spent
true